Just as teaching for meaning has positive effects on student learning, retention, and inquisitiveness, 19 teaching with technology, specifically Dynamic Geometry, is being shown to improve mathematics performance. Teachers know that bringing a strong visual component to mathematics is key to understanding for all students, 4 and indispensible for students challenged by language learning and cognitive issues.
